A Fox (brand) shotgun once belonging to TR, and carried on his African safari, will be on display at the Panhandle-Plains Historical Museum, from May 28, through at least the end of the summer.

The Jason Roselius Trust is loaning the artifact, said to be TR's favorite, which became the most expensive shotgun in history, when Roselius paid $862,500 for it in 2010.

Roselius was a graduate of Panhandle High School, and WTAMU, on whose campus the museum is located. He got a law degree from OU, and was practicing law in OKC. He died last January at age 48, trying to rescue his dogs from an icy pond.
